From mboxrd@z Thu Jan 1 00:00:00 1970 From: p.zabel@pengutronix.de (Philipp Zabel) Date: Fri, 13 Jan 2017 12:59:32 +0100 Subject: [PATCH v3 05/24] ARM: dts: imx6qdl-sabrelite: remove erratum ERR006687 workaround In-Reply-To: <1483755102-24785-6-git-send-email-steve_longerbeam@mentor.com> References: <1483755102-24785-1-git-send-email-steve_longerbeam@mentor.com> <1483755102-24785-6-git-send-email-steve_longerbeam@mentor.com> Message-ID: <1484308772.31475.25.camel@pengutronix.de> To: linux-arm-kernel@lists.infradead.org List-Id: linux-arm-kernel.lists.infradead.org Am Freitag, den 06.01.2017, 18:11 -0800 schrieb Steve Longerbeam: > There is a pin conflict with GPIO_6. This pin functions as a power > input pin to the OV5642 camera sensor, but ENET uses it as the h/w > workaround for erratum ERR006687, to wake-up the ARM cores on normal > RX and TX packet done events. So we need to remove the h/w workaround > to support the OV5642. The result is that the CPUidle driver will no > longer allow entering the deep idle states on the sabrelite. > > This is a partial revert of > > commit 6261c4c8f13e ("ARM: dts: imx6qdl-sabrelite: use GPIO_6 for FEC > interrupt.") > commit a28eeb43ee57 ("ARM: dts: imx6: tag boards that have the HW workaround > for ERR006687") > > Signed-off-by: Steve Longerbeam Pity this has to be removed for all, Nitrogen6X should really use DT overlays for the add-on boards / cameras. regards Philipp